Computer Science and Software Engineering

Universitetas
Bedfordshire University
Miestas, šalis
Luton, England
Studijų trukmė
3 m.
Programos sritys
Computer Sciences, Software Engineering
Studijų kaina
9250.00 GBP
Studijų kalba
English (ENG)
Laipsnis
Bachelor
Programos pradžia
2022-09-19
Stojimo pabaiga
2023-01-15
Apie programą
Stojimo reikalavimai
Karjeros galimybės

Computer science is at the core of modern technology, and at the heart of a number of specialist technology fields. This course shares a common first stage with our other BSc degrees in Computer Science to give you a foundation, as well as providing a platform for specialist study in the second and third stages, during which you will learn, in depth, the principles and practices of both disciplines computer science and software engineering.

The disciplines of computer science and software engineering are central to many of today's commercial and industrial activities, as well as providing a diverse and rapidly developing field for personal study. This course is designed to enable you to analyse and build a range of applications. Emphasis is on the entire software development lifecycle, and the production of high-quality software systems using object-oriented (OO) methods and tools.
You'll explore the entire systems development life-cycle, as well as comprehensively covering OO methods. The final-stage project enables you to take your specialist work to greater depth, leading to the possibility of future research.
The emphasis of the course is to provide vocationally skilled programmers and software engineers who have both a general overview of computer science an software engineering, with a more detailed knowledge of fields like internet programming, database applications, artificial intelligence applications or networking.
During the course you will:
  • Explore a broad-based curriculum, yet with enough depth to acquire credible vocational skills
  • Cover a variety of computer science areas, typically delivered by an expert in the relevant field
  • Cover the entire systems lifecycle
  • Take advantage of close links with local companies
  • Use state-of-the-art software development environments
  • Benefit from the Universitys research activity in the area of Computer Science
  • Be taught by staff with relevant experience in industry and commerce
Areas of study you may cover on this course include:
  • Software engineering management
  • System methodologies: Unified Modelling Language (UML), OO
  • Risk management and quality issues
  • Develop skills using a variety of tools (such as as Microsoft's .NET framework-building application)
  • Testing
Reikalaujamas išsilavinimas

Stojant į šį universitetą dėmesys yra kreipiamas į pažymius ir Brandos atestato vidurkį, kuris turi būti ne žemesnis kaip 5 + laikytų brandos egzaminų vidurkis ne mažesis kaip 50%.

  • Pažymių išrašas - jei dar nesi baigęs mokyklos, būtina prisegti pažymių išrašą. Smulkesnę informaciją kaip pildyti išrašą ir kada jis reikalingas, rasi čia.*

  • Brandos atestatas – jei jau esi baigęs mokyklą, išrašo nereikia, užtenka prie Kastu stojimo anketos prisegti savo Brandos atestatą.

Anglų kalbos reikalavimai

Svarbu, jog anglų kalbos testo rezultatai universitetą pasiektų iki Liepos 31d.

Anglų kalbos žinias gali patvirtinti vienu iš šių būdų:

  • Anglų kalbos vidurkis 8 B2 lygiu.

  • IELTS - 6.0

  • TOEFL – 80

Career/Further study opportunities

Career paths
It is possible to identify several different roles that graduates of the joint degree pathway are expected to fulfil - competent software engineering technician, trainee computer programmer / software developer - and these vocational outcomes have formed the basis of this strategically planned curriculum. Initially, students are likely to gain jobs as a skilled practitioner with the prospect for later progression leading to posts of responsibility supervising working within a team based development and support settings within significantly large, as well small scale, industrial and commercial settings. The aim of the pathway is primarily seen to equip graduates to develop the intellectual and pragmatic skills needed to develop quality software artefacts that not only function and meet client requirements, but also fit within the pragmatic constraints. The role of external and internal standards is also emphasised as being vital. Equally, such topics will equip the graduate to proceed to a higher degree and or participate effectively within a research or academic setting. An important feature of the joint pathway is that the entire software production lifecycle is covered.
Further study:
  • MSc in a Software Engineering related topic; MPhil / PhD.